Description

Price Industries Inc.is on the search for a Value Stream Manager (Operations Manager) on 2nd Shift for our growing US office and manufacturing facility located in Suwanee GA.The Value Stream Manager is responsible for the overall performance of Manufacturing and Service in the Value Stream (and all departments within the Value Stream) including Quality Cost Delivery Safety Training Morale and Continuous Improvement. This position interfaces with Sales Engineering Customer Service Production Planning Information Technology Purchasing Human Resources in support of Price Industries efforts of becoming a WorldClass Manufacturer.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Owner of the Value Stream(s) he/she manages and all the departments within it

  • Efficiency and Utilization (i.e. Productivity) of the Value Stream

  • Quality of the products built and effective resolution of quality issues

  • Process and product flow through the Value St ream

  • Budgeting controlling costs within budget and cost reduction within area

  • Responsible in part for the Gross Margin of the Value Stream and directly responsible for the Labor Cost of Sales (LCOS)

  • Process standardization process improvement and overall continuous improvement Projects and Objectives and managing Value Stream Improvement activities

  • Capacity / Manpower Planning and effective staffing

  • Ensuring that product acceptance criteria is clearly understood

  • Responsible for Health Safety and Environment procedure compliance

  • Responsible for maintaining and publishing performance Metrics

  • Act as a mentor for Supervisors and support them with discipline interdepartmental communication and other items when necessary coupled with knowledge and adherence to the Collective Bargaining Agreement

  • Represent the Value Stream as necessary at meetings briefings etc

  • Interface with the customer when called upon by Sales and Customer Service personnel

  • Working with Sales Engineering and customer on the development and introduction of new products in production

  • Create a work environment conducive to employee morale motivation growth and teamwork to accomplish performance objectives

  • Each Value Stream Manager is challenged to find innovative ways to improve productivity and reduce cost. The Value Stream Manager must have control of costs within their Value Stream. Each Value Stream Manager is accountable for the budget within their Value Stream and will negotiate services with the Support Groups (i.e. Manufacturing Engineering Design Engineering etc. in order to achieve cost reduction objectives.

  • Other duties as assigned

QUALIFICATIONS

  • BS degree in Engineering (Mechanical or Industrial) / Supply Chain

  • 5 years of supervision with a proven track record in a high volume multiproduct environment.

  • Exceptional leadership skills accompanied by a sense of urgency.

  • Comfortable in a team oriented environment where success of the company is of paramount importance.

  • Ability to achieve desired results by motivating Associates to want to meet goals.

  • Strong initiative and able to work with minimum supervision.

  • Excellent communication skills.

  • Proficient in MS Office applications.

  • Thrive in a work environment where teamwork accountability and innovative thinking are highly valued.

  • Ability to read electrical and mechanical schematics.

  • Proven ability to drive improvement in a product line through leading design changes and process improvement.

  • Six Sigma Greenbelt/Lean a plus
